The Duty of Concrete Crushers in Recycling



Concrete crushers play an essential role in the recycling process by effectively minimizing concrete waste right into smaller, workable pieces. This subtopic will explore the importance of these crushers in the general recycling process.


The primary function of concrete crushers is to break down huge portions of concrete waste right into smaller sized, a lot more workable pieces. These crushers use powerful jaws or hammers to apply pressure and pressure, successfully damaging the concrete into smaller pieces. By doing so, they make it easier to transfer, deal with, and process the concrete waste.


In addition, concrete crushers add to the reduction of landfill waste. Instead of getting rid of big chunks of concrete, which can occupy substantial room in garbage dumps, crushers break them down right into smaller sized pieces that can be reused or repurposed. This not just saves valuable land fill room yet likewise helps to preserve natural deposits by recycling the concrete waste in building projects.


Moreover, concrete crushers make it possible for the separation of rebar and other steel elements from the concrete waste. This is achieved via using magnetic separators or specialized attachments that can draw out the metal components, allowing them to be reused individually.


Benefits of Making Use Of Concrete Crushers for Recycling



When it comes to the reusing process,Concrete crushers use various advantages. One of the major advantages is that they can lower the size of concrete particles, making it easier and a lot more affordable to transport and recycle. By breaking down concrete into smaller items, crushers allow for efficient sorting and separation of various products, such as rebar and concrete aggregates. This not just boosts the general recycling price but likewise reduces the demand for new resources, hence promoting sustainability.


Another benefit of utilizing concrete crushers is the decrease of ecological influence. By reusing concrete, the amount of waste sent to garbage dumps is significantly decreased, causing reduced disposal prices and much less strain on limited garbage dump area. In addition, the manufacturing of brand-new concrete requires a considerable amount of energy and resources, including water and aggregates. By recycling concrete, the demand for these sources is decreased, resulting in a lower carbon footprint and a much more sustainable building market.


Furthermore, concrete crushers can additionally add to the financial advantages of reusing. Recycling concrete develops task possibilities in the waste administration and reusing industry, in addition to in the manufacturing of recycled concrete accumulations. Additionally, utilizing recycled concrete aggregates in brand-new building and construction tasks can cause cost savings, as these products are commonly less expensive than virgin aggregates.


Trick Attributes of Effective Concrete Crushers



One essential element of reliable concrete crushers is their capability to manage a large range of concrete debris dimensions effectively and accurately. Concrete crushers are created to damage down concrete right into smaller sized items, making it less complicated to carry and recycle. They should have the ability to deal with numerous sizes of concrete particles, from little pieces to large blocks, without compromising their efficiency. This is very important because building and construction websites create various sizes of concrete debris, and a versatile crusher can manage them all.


One more trick attribute of effective concrete crushers is their durability and strength. They must be constructed with top quality materials that can hold up against the harsh conditions of concrete crushing. The crusher's elements, such as the jaws and the squashing plates, need to be made from solid products that can resist wear and tear. This guarantees that the crusher can run efficiently for a very long time, decreasing downtime and maintenance expenses.


Performance is additionally a vital feature of reliable concrete crushers. A reliable crusher can dramatically increase the efficiency of concrete recycling procedures and minimize the need for manual labor.

Future Trends and Innovations in Concrete Crusher Innovation

Advancements in concrete crusher modern technology are forming the future of the recycling market. One of the vital trends in concrete crusher innovation is the usage of innovative materials and finishings to boost the durability and longevity of the devices.


An additional vital technology in concrete crusher technology is the advancement of intelligent systems that enhance the squashing procedure. These systems make use of sensing units and progressed formulas to monitor and change the crusher's efficiency in real-time. By evaluating information such as feed dimension, material firmness, and crusher setups, these smart systems can enhance the squashing process for maximum effectiveness and efficiency. This not just minimizes power he said usage and operating costs however likewise guarantees constant and top notch outcome.


Moreover, innovations in automation and remote innovation are reinventing the way concrete crushers are run. Remote-controlled crushers permit operators to safely and successfully manage the squashing process from a range, reducing the danger of crashes and boosting functional flexibility. Furthermore, automation technology makes it possible for crushers to be integrated into bigger recycling systems, streamlining the overall recycling procedure and raising efficiency.
